Input block: supported by which Fractal Audio products

  • Axe-Fx III: 5x.
  • Axe-Fx II: 1x.
  • AX8: 1x.
  • FX8: no.

Input block: X/Y switching or channels

  • Axe-Fx III: 4 channels.
  • Axe-Fx II: no.
  • AX8: no.
  • FX8: n/a.

Position of the Input block

  • Axe-Fx II and AX8: the input block has a fixed position at the start of the grid.
  • Axe-Fx III: there are multiple input blocks which can be positioned freely on the grid.

(Axe-Fx III) "Each input block has a built-in gate." source

Input block as a Global Block

The settings of the Input block can be saved as a Global Block in the Axe-Fx II.
